Output 29c67254fcc8ffd3d343cf61ef16b54ad0a75274a77837064b652cd2005843ba: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e784ded5187c642af8f0e0b47158d6a40c31fb0 OP_EQUALVERIFY OP_CHECKSIG
address
1B57SzsVjpMJHENdQpmZ92qfgWi7y6er43
transaction
29c67254fcc8ffd3d343cf61ef16b54ad0a75274a77837064b652cd2005843ba
spent
true